# Pat Fitzmaurice — prediction record

Pat Fitzmaurice is the managing editor at FantasyPros and BettingPros, where he shapes the editorial direction for two of fantasy sports' most-visited destinations. A Milwaukee native and Green Bay Packers fan, he's built his career across outlets including Pro Football Weekly, Tribune Media Services, 4for4, and The Football Girl. His work at FantasyPros covers the full spectrum of fantasy football decision-making — sleepers, busts, draft strategy, and the preseason tea-leaf reading that separates the prepared from the hopeful. He's also a regular voice on podcasts and video segments, including appearances on The Herd with Colin Cowherd, breaking down the players and picks that define each fantasy season.

## Record

- **Accuracy:** 58.03%
- **MissedTakes Score:** 47.24
- **Graded articles:** 23
- **Graded individual calls:** 168
- **Clarity:** 98.57%

LIMITED SAMPLE: between 10 and 29 graded articles. Treat with caution.

The MissedTakes Score is how much better than a naive baseline they did, not how often they were right. Zero means no better than a strategy requiring no knowledge. A record is counted in ARTICLES rather than individual calls, because thirty picks in one mock draft is one act of judgment rather than thirty.
